Bekaert to close wire rod production facility in British Columbia

Thursday, 07 November 2013 01:29:08 (GMT+3)   |   San Diego
       

The management of Bekaert Group announced Wednesday the decision to phase out its operations in the Surrey plant, British Columbia, Canada, which will affect 110 employees.

The Surrey plant is active in the production of steel wire for various industrial applications. Bekaert has observed a downward movement in the market for these product lines in the Northwest of the North American market, leading to a structural production overcapacity in the relevant market segments. In addition, aggressive competition from Asian countries is putting continuous pressure on sales prices.

These external developments have had a strong negative impact on the profitability of Bekaert Canada Limited and on the competitive position of the respective operations in the North American market, calling for a realignment of the production platform in that region.

Management regrets the need to implement this measure, but sees no other option to safeguard a long-term competitive position of its steel wire activities in North America. Conversations with employee representatives on an adjustment plan, detailing the provisions of the closure, will commence immediately.

Bekaert intends to continue to serve its customers and markets in North America from its other North American manufacturing sites.
